WOMEN'S BASKETBALL

Notre Dame reserves ready to help starters with heavy NCAA lifting

Tom Noie
South Bend Tribune

CHICAGO — The eye roll said it all.

It was mid-October, before the Notre Dame women’s basketball team won at least 30 games for a ninth straight season. Before the Irish won a sixth Atlantic Coast Conference tournament championship, secured another No. 1 seed in the NCAA tournament or advanced to the Sweet 16 for a 10th-straight season.

Before all of that arrived, one prominent player was asked something in relation to how it all ended — last season when the Irish surfed a short postseason rotation of basically six all the way to the school’s second national championship.

A deep and talented and healthy team to start this season, would the returners welcome more options on the bench?
